// Broker upgrade notes for plugin authors:
// Quillbus 4.x replaces the legacy 3.x wire protocol. Plugins must
// construct the client with explicit protocol negotiation enabled,
// or connections to the Larkfield cluster will be silently downgraded
// and dropped after 30s. Topic names are unchanged. For local testing
// against the sandbox broker, authenticate with the key below.

API key for bafof-bagaf: qvz2-qi

## Changelog — ScanBridge v4.2.0

The setting formerly named `SB_API_PASS` has been renamed to `SB_BROKER_SECRET` to reflect that it authenticates against the Quillmark barcode broker, not the legacy API gateway. The old name is ignored as of this release; startup will fail loudly if only `SB_API_PASS` is set. On-call: when rotating, update the env file with the line below:

env line for fafof-fahag: LEDGER_TOKEN5=f8790

TICKET GX-PROF: Vault locked on profbox-3. The Kernwatch GPU memory profiler license bundle lives in the Slagmark vault, which auto-locked after the last rotation. You're new, so short version: you need the bundle to run allocation traces on the Heliotrope cluster. Don't file a new key request; recovery is faster. Open the vault console, pick "restore from passphrase," and confirm the node name. Use the recovery passphrase below.

recovery phrase for kagup-kawif: zorael-holael

CI troubleshooting — broker upgrade. The Quillhopper pipeline fails intermittently since we bumped the Marrowbus broker to the 4.x line. Symptom: consumer acks time out during the integration stage, then the job retries and usually passes. Suspect the new heartbeat default. Workaround: pin the heartbeat to 30s in the stage config and rerun. Do not downgrade the broker; schema migrations are one-way. If retries exceed three, escalate. The last known-good pipeline run is referenced below.

session token of tajef-bageg = htk21_5d90d574934f3ccae6437